Output ddc80e399e971e1444faeb111b7784d555a8841f12ea454a9252c83f5ee84c56:4

value
108339808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ba8e6efcffdf301e3d430ee0a51a52ef472ccc OP_EQUAL
address
MCoFXm8wUE3aVWQA33dKjbxczDxpHYCjNH
transaction
ddc80e399e971e1444faeb111b7784d555a8841f12ea454a9252c83f5ee84c56
spent
true